Milan's Pierce Signs with The Mount

Pierce is a two-time All-State selection.

Ethan Pierce signs to play football at Mount St. Joseph University. Photo by Milan Community Schools. 

(Milan, Ind.) – Ethan Pierce is taking his talents to Ohio to play college football.

The Milan High School senior recently signed his letter of intent to continue his academic and athletic career at Mount St. Joseph University.

Pierce is a two-time IFCA All-State selection, earning the honor as a junior and a senior.

Over the course of his high school career, Pierce starred as a tight end and a linebacker.

He was Milan’s leading tackler as a senior, totaling 84 takedowns including 13 for a loss. Pierce had 87 tackles as a junior and 72 as a sophomore.

Offensively, Pierce had 49 career receptions for 697 yards and nine touchdowns.

In 2023, the Mount St. Joseph roster featured several local players, including Devon Donawerth (East Central), Kyle Farfsing (Harrison), Brady Hornberger (Batesville), Johnny Volk (Milan), Devin Salyers (East Central), Noah Houser (East Central), Chandler Reatherford (Milan), Joey Hibbard (Lawrenceburg), and Anthony Kuhr (Taylor).
